FORT EISENHOWER, Ga. - The U.S. Army Signal Regiment celebrated 19 graduates of the 255N Warrant Officer Basic Course (WOBC) Class 002-25, June 4.
Chief Warrant Officer 5 Willie Newkirk, technical director for the U.S. Army Signal School, emphasized the significance of the role each 255N will have at their gaining unit.
“As new network operations warrant officers, you now bear critical responsibility to secure, optimize, and operationalize the very foundation of the Army’s command and control: the unified network,” Newkirk said. “As you step into your first assignment, lead with confidence, humility, and purpose.”
Serving as guest speaker for the ceremony, Signal Regimental Chief Warrant Officer 5 Chris Westbrook offered graduates a few tips for being successful as members of the Signal Warrant Officer Cohort.
“Remember your primary job is to make your boss successful, because what your boss is trying to do is enable the Warfighter,” Westbrook said. “Be present. If you don’t have a seat at the table, get that seat at the table, and take that seat every single time.”
Presence in training, presence in attitude … presence in everything will contribute to mission success.
“When Chief walks in the room, they need to know that you’re going to solve their problems – that you’re going to be a benefit to their organization,” Westbrook continued. “It’s a feeling of the team’s confidence in you, and the feeling that you have confidence in your team, that is highly important.”
